Members of Wessex Mead Rotary were raising club funds and supporting Trowbridge Snooker Player Adam Wicheard this weekend at the 4 day Beer and Cider Festival at the Rising Sun Bradford on Avon.  This Charity Rhythm and Booze Festival is raising funds for Dorothy House Hospice and we have taken the oportunity to be involved by running the BBQ on Saturday afternoon/early evening.

More than £90 was raised at the event and we would like to thank Liz at the Rising Sun.

SNOOKER star Adam Wicheard has followed in the footsteps of fellow Trowbridge cueman Stephen Lee by earning a place on the sport’s professional circuit. The 24 year-old, who went to Clarendon School, finished top of the Pro-Ticket Tour rankings to clinch his place. Wicheard’s achievement caps a sensational comeback for the Trowbridge ace, who suffered a career-threatening neck injury in May 2006. After recovering from having a tumour removed from his spinal cord, Wicheard is now getting ready to start life as a pro, but will have to play the waiting game before he starts marking dates on his calendar
